    Thanks guys.

    The bronze is Geedub Tin Bitz, heavily drybrushed with Dwarf Copper, and then with a Devlan Mud wash, and finally Badab Black in the really recessed areas.

    The gems are a base coat of black, followed with Red Gore, blend in Blood Red and then a final slight blend of Blazing Orange. Add a white dot in the corner, and then gloss varnish it.
